Buying Guide for the Best Moringa Oils

Choosing the right moringa oil can make a big difference in your skincare, haircare, or wellness routine. Moringa oil is valued for its nourishing properties, but not all oils are created equal. When shopping, it's important to look beyond the label and understand what makes one moringa oil different from another. By focusing on a few key specifications, you can find an oil that best matches your needs, whether you want it for moisturizing, cooking, or therapeutic uses.
Extraction MethodThe extraction method refers to how the oil is taken from the moringa seeds. This is important because it affects the purity, nutrient content, and overall quality of the oil. Cold-pressed oils are extracted without heat, preserving more nutrients and making them ideal for skincare and haircare. Expeller-pressed or solvent-extracted oils may lose some beneficial compounds or contain residues. If you want the most natural and nutrient-rich oil, look for cold-pressed options. If you are less concerned about maximum nutrients and more about cost or availability, other methods may suffice.
PurityPurity indicates whether the oil is 100% moringa or mixed with other oils or additives. Pure moringa oil is best for those seeking the full benefits for skin, hair, or health. Blended oils may be less effective or could cause reactions if you have sensitivities. Always check the ingredient list; if you want the full effect of moringa, choose oils labeled as 100% pure or unrefined. If you are using it for general moisturizing and don't mind blends, a mixed oil might be suitable.
Refinement LevelRefinement level tells you how much the oil has been processed after extraction. Unrefined or raw moringa oil retains more of its natural scent, color, and nutrients, making it a good choice for those who want the most natural product. Refined oils are lighter in color and scent, and may be better for those with sensitive skin or who prefer a neutral smell. If you want the most natural experience, go for unrefined; if you prefer a milder oil, refined may be better.
PackagingPackaging refers to the type of container the oil comes in. This matters because moringa oil can degrade when exposed to light and air. Dark glass bottles help protect the oil from sunlight and preserve its quality, while plastic or clear bottles may not offer the same protection. If you plan to use the oil over a long period, choose one in a dark glass bottle to keep it fresh. If you use it quickly, packaging may be less critical.
Intended UseIntended use means what you want the oil for—skin, hair, cooking, or massage. Some moringa oils are specifically processed for cosmetic use, while others are food-grade. If you want to use it on your skin or hair, make sure it is labeled for cosmetic use. If you plan to cook with it, ensure it is food-grade and safe for consumption. Your main purpose should guide your choice to ensure safety and effectiveness.
